Ottawa University - Surprise is located in Surprise, Arizona and has a total student population of 831. In the 2020-2021 academic year, 27 students received a bachelor's degree in business administration from Ottawa University - Surprise.

How Much Do Business Administration Graduates from Ottawa University - Surprise Make?

The median salary of business administration students who receive their bachelor's degree at Ottawa University - Surprise is $34,341. Unfortunately, this is lower than the national average of $41,334 for all business administration students.

Careers That Business Administration Grads May Go Into

A degree in business administration can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for AZ, the home state for Ottawa University - Surprise.

Occupation Jobs in AZ Average Salary in AZ
General and Operations Managers 50,540 $102,470
Office and Administrative Support Worker Supervisors 36,130 $54,670
Retail Sales Supervisors 24,730 $41,680
Management Analysts 10,830 $85,890
Mechanic, and Repairer Supervisors 10,720 $63,860
